Detailing the development trend of CNC machine tool technology

High-speed, precision, composite, intelligent and green are the general trends in the development of CNC machine tools. In recent years, we have achieved gratifying results in terms of practicality and industrialization. Mainly manifested in:

1. Further expansion of machine tool composite technology With the advancement of CNC machine tool technology, composite processing technology is becoming more and more mature, including milling-vehicle compounding, turning-milling compounding, car-镗-drill-gear processing and other composites, car grinding compounding, forming compound processing, special Composite processing, etc., the precision and efficiency of composite processing is greatly improved. The concept of “one machine tool is a processing plant”, “one-time loading, complete processing” is being accepted by more people, and the development of composite processing machine tools is showing a diversified trend.

2. Intelligent technology has a new breakthrough. The intelligent technology of CNC machine tools has a new breakthrough, and it has been more reflected in the performance of CNC system. Such as: automatic adjustment of interference anti-collision function, workpiece automatically exits safety zone power-off protection function after power-off, machining part detection and automatic compensation learning function, high-precision machining parts intelligent parameter selection function, machining process automatically eliminates machine vibration and other functions In the practical stage, intelligent improvement of the function and quality of the machine tool.

3. The robot makes the flexible combination higher. The flexible combination of the robot and the host is widely used, which makes the flexible line more flexible, the function is further expanded, the flexible line is further shortened, and the efficiency is higher. Robotic and machining centers, turning and milling machine tools, grinding machines, gear processing machines, tool grinding machines, electric machine tools, sawing machines, stamping machines, laser processing machines, water cutting machines, etc. have begun to be applied in various forms of flexible units and flexible production lines.

4. Precision machining technology has made new progress The machining accuracy of CNC gold cutting machine tools has been improved from the original wire grade (0.01mm) to the current micrometer (0.001mm), and some varieties have reached 0.05μm. The ultra-precision CNC machine tool's micro-cutting and grinding process can achieve a stable accuracy of about 0.05μm and a shape accuracy of about 0.01μm. Special processing precision using optical, electrical, chemical and other energy sources can reach nanometer scale (0.001μm). Through machine structure design optimization, super-finishing and precision assembly of machine parts, high-precision full-closed control and dynamic error compensation techniques such as temperature and vibration, the geometric accuracy of machine tool processing is improved, and the shape and position errors, surface roughness, etc. are reduced. In order to enter the sub-micron, nano-scale super-precision era.

5. Continuous improvement of functional components Functional components continue to develop in the direction of high speed, high precision, high power and intelligence, and have achieved mature applications. All-digital AC servo motor and drive device, high-tech electric spindle, torque motor, linear motor, high-performance linear rolling component, high-precision spindle unit and other functional components are promoted and applied, greatly improving the technical level of CNC machine tools.
